Phase 5 — Jetstream Trigger#

Subscribe to the AT Protocol firehose via Jetstream and trigger n8n workflows on matching events. Zero new dependencies — uses Node 22+ built-in WebSocket and node:zlib zstd (with Jetstream's custom dictionary).

Files#

Colocated in src/nodes/Atproto/:

  • AtprotoJetstream.trigger.ts — trigger node class
  • jetstream.ts — WebSocket client, reconnection, types
  • zstd_dictionary — static binary asset (110KB, from Jetstream repo)

Build changes: new entry in vite.config.build.ts, copy dictionary in writeBundle, add to package.json n8n.nodes[], barrel export in index.ts.

Output Format (flattened)#

Raw Jetstream JSON is restructured for n8n ergonomics:

// Commit events:
{ "did": "did:plc:...", "timeUs": 1725911162329308, "kind": "commit",
  "operation": "create", "collection": "app.bsky.feed.post", "rkey": "3l3qo...",
  "rev": "3l3qo2vutsw2b", "cid": "bafyrei...",
  "record": { "$type": "app.bsky.feed.post", "text": "...", ... } }

// Identity events:
{ "did": "did:plc:...", "timeUs": ..., "kind": "identity",
  "handle": "user.bsky.social", "seq": 1409752997, "time": "..." }

// Account events:
{ "did": "did:plc:...", "timeUs": ..., "kind": "account",
  "active": true, "status": "active", "seq": ..., "time": "..." }

WebSocket Client (jetstream.ts)#

  • Module-level lazy-loaded zstd dictionary (cached forever after first load)
  • Reconnection: exponential backoff (1s → 2s → 4s … cap 30s)
  • Cursor rewind 3s on reconnect for gapless playback
  • stopped flag respected by reconnection loop (set by closeFunction)
  • Internal types for all 3 event kinds (no external type deps)

Trigger Lifecycle#

  1. Read parameters (endpoint, collections, DIDs, kinds, operations, compress)
  2. Load persisted cursor from getWorkflowStaticData('node')
  3. If compress=true, lazy-load zstd dictionary
  4. Build WebSocket URL with query params
  5. Connect + listen → decompress → parse → filter by kind/operation → this.emit()
  6. closeFunction: set stopped, close WS, persist cursor to static data
  7. manualTriggerFunction: connect, wait up to ~30s for first matching event, disconnect
